Frank Cardaci Traineeship and Apprenticeship Program
Building futures. Creating opportunities.
Established in 2015, the Frank Cardaci Traineeship & Apprenticeship Program honours the legacy of CFC Group founder and his belief that everyone deserves a chance. This program is designed to provide real career pathways across our group of businesses while empowering individuals with practical skills, hands-on experience and long-term stability.
Why join the program?
- Full-time, paid employment
- Hands-on industry experience
- Dedicated mentors and trainers
- Nationally recognised qualifications
- Real career progression opportunities
Qualifications on offer:
- Certificate III Civil Construction
- Certificate III Trenchless Technology
- Certificate III Surface Extraction
- Certificate III Electrotechnology
- Certificate III Heavy Commercial Vehicle Mechanical Technology
- Certificate III Automotive Electrical Technology

Emmanuel’s pathway
Emmanuel Langoya joined Cape Dunstans in 2023 as a graduate after completing a Bachelor of Health Science at Edith Cowan University in Western Australia, majoring in Health Promotion and Occupational Health and Safety. Drawn by the company’s strong focus on innovation, safety and employee development, he embraced opportunities to gain experience across a range of projects. Through structured development programs, mentoring and exposure to real-world challenges, Emmanuel has progressed to become a Project Health, Safety and Environment (HSE) Advisor. Emmanuel’s story reflects our commitment to developing emerging talent and building the next generation of safety leaders.

Graduate program
Launch your career with Cape Dunstans.
Our Graduate Program is designed to develop the next generation of industry leaders through hands-on experience, mentorship and real responsibility. Over a two-year period, graduates rotate across key areas of the business, gaining broad exposure and valuable insight.
Program highlights:
- 2-year structured program
- Rotations every 6 months
- Exposure to diverse projects and industries
- Mentorship from experienced professionals
Who we’re looking for: degree-qualified (Mechanical or Process Engineering preferred), strong communication and teamwork skills, highly organised with excellent time management, driven, proactive and eager to learn.
